More oil companies = more jobs for the unemployed



When choosing to support the job market or paying the individual for not working, it's always better for the country as a whole to do the first.


What we really need is less subsidies AND less taxes. Let the companies sustain themselves fairly.
What about the companies that hire people, but don't pay high enough wages for the person to support themselves with a full-time job? Personally, I agree. Subsidies should not be given out easily. I don't think we need less taxes, I do think we need simpler and harder to evade tax laws. Overall, I think companies should be able to both survive and allow their employees to survive without outside assistance, if they are unable to, they shouldn't be in business.

The caveat is I believe subsidies are necessary for certain products/services. There are certain things that simply cannot be profitable, but greatly benefit us as a country. For instance, ensuring everyone has access to high speed internet, power, telephone, etc. There may not be the ability to make a profit there, but it is important for us, as a country, to ensure certain basic necessities to everyone.
